Some ideas
  • Try turning off the fading images
  • Test with a different menu
  • Test different image and menu settings
  • Try a plugin for the header images instead of the build in image function
This could be related to the combination of the megamenu and the fading header images.

Good ole IE is at it again. Does IE work if you set the images to not rotate?

The script used for the image rotation is a bit old and that in confunction with the menu you are using COULD be problematic. If you shut off rotation and IE behaves I would definitely try a plugin for images. I like Cimy Header Image Rotator.

add a new widget area to the 'configure header area' option
HTML Code:
 <?php bfa_widget_area('name=widget area for CHIR'); ?>
add a text widget
add the CHIR code

With the Cimy rotator you can just past the code they give you in place of %pages in the Configure Header Area Box. You don't need to add a widget area for this particular plugin.
